You might be having some transfer addiction to the caffeine. I went through the same thing, but I found that the increased caffeine was giving me gastritis which can lead to an ulcer. I suspect I've always been sensitive to caffeine since my symptoms were familiar to me, but I actually got checked out due to my increased vigilance with stomach issues post RNY.

Some folks drink a lot of coffee and it doesn't bother them, but I caution you to pay attention to how you feel. It took me a while to put two and two together. :D Now I limit myself to two caffeine drinks a day and do decaf in the evenings and I haven't had any recurrence of the stomach pain in almost two years.

That's a good idea. Sometimes I'll have three in a day, but then I feel like I'm skating close to the danger zone. What threw me off was I wouldn't feel badly until several hours after and it felt like when you have really bad gas pains high up, you know? So I thought it was just gas and I'd go to bed and usually be absolutely fine the next morning. No soreness or nothing.

One day, it started happening during the daytime while I was at work and it just wasn't getting better, so I went to the Urgent Care. They gave me what they call a "gastric ****tail" which I understood was mylanta with some lidocaine. Well, it numbed my mouth and throat, but did nothing for the pain. When I thought about it later, it made sense because the issue was in my remnant stomach which the lidocaine would have never reached because it's sealed off. I definitely didn't want to get an ulcer in my remnant stomach!

So pay attention to how you feel. :D
